tMDMOutput Update shows in journal but record value is unchanged

Hello,
Trying to fill in an empty double field in an MDM model, I seem to have gotten tMDMOutput to generate an appropriate Update operation, yet the web UI shows me a field that remains empty.
Note that I am just beginning to use Talend, so this is likely due to something very obvious, that I just can't put the finger on.

After looking in the JIRA database ( https://jira.talendforge.org/browse/TMDM-6816 ), Patch_TMDM_V5.3.1.r104014_20131128 seems to fix, and it looks OK on our side. You can either ask it to the Talend support or wait for v5.3.2 that should be released in the next days.
